I Know Why the Caged Bird Sings Trailer

I Know Why the Caged Bird Sings Trailer (1979)

28 April 1979 Drama, TV Movie 96 mins

Based on writer Maya Angelou's eloquent reminiscences of her days as a gifted youngster growing up in the South during the Depression years where she and her older brother were raised by their grandmother after the divorce of their parents.
